WitrynaBig Ben is the nickname for the Great Bell of the clock at the north end of the Palace of Westminster in London and is usually extended to refer to both the clock and the clock tower as well. The tower is officially known as Elizabeth Tower, renamed to celebrate the Diamond Jubilee of Elizabeth II in 2012; previously, it was known simply as the Clock …

WitrynaBig Ben facts. Each dial is seven metres in diameter. The minute hands are 4.2 metres long (14ft) and weigh about 100kg (220lbs, including counterweights). The numbers are approximately 60cm (23in) long. There are 312 pieces of glass in each clock dial. A special light above the clock faces is illuminated when parliament is in session. He’s known for his op-eds and diary pieces ... WitrynaThe tower was built from the inside out. Londoners could see the tower slowly rise above the city with no workmen or materials visible. Sixty-one meters of brickwork covered with sand-coloured Anston stone rose out of the ground before the two-tier iron spire was added.
